c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
751
Views
0
Helpful
2
Replies

Cisco Unified SIP Proxy 9.1.6 (BUG?): work only one Post-Normalization Trigger with high sequence

bankspb
Level 1
Level 1

I have 5 Post-Normalization Trigger

 

trigger routing sequence 1 by-pass condition mid-dialog

trigger routing sequence 2 policy Route_Policies_ALL condition IN_Network_Side_A

trigger routing sequence 3 policy Route_Policies_ALL condition OUT_Network_Side_A

trigger post-normalization sequence 4 policy Remove_Prefix_0800_for_0800-Calls-from-CUCM-to-CVP condition OUT_Network_Side_A

trigger post-normalization sequence 5 policy Remove_Prefix_0801_for_0801-Calls-from-CUCM-to-CVP-with-Courtesy-Callback condition OUT_Network_Side_A

trigger post-normalization sequence 7 policy From_ISDN_Called_Number_Prefix_332_Remove condition OUT_Network_Side_A

trigger post-normalization sequence 8 policy From_ISDN_Called_Number_Prefix_329_Remove condition OUT_Network_Side_A

trigger post-normalization sequence 9 policy From_ISDN_Called_Number_Prefix_329_Remove condition IN_Network_Side_A  

 

BUT CUSP search  match only with 1 post-normalization  trigger with highest sequence (trigger post-normalization sequence 4) and ignore another triggers:  

C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 conditions.RegexCondition - OUT_NETWORK: null

[C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 conditions.RegexCondition - OUT_NETWORK: Network_Side_A

[C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 conditions.AbstractRegexCondition - pattern(^\QNetwork_Side_A\E$), toMatch(Network_Side_A) returning true

[C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 triggers.ModuleTrigger - ModuleTrigger.eval() action<Remove_Prefix_0800_for_0800-Calls-from-CUCM-to-CVP> actionParameter<>

[C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 triggers.ModuleTrigger - ModuleTrigger.eval() got the policy, executing it ...

[C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 util.Normalization - Leaving Normalization.normalize()

[CT_CALLBACK.12] DEBUG 2018.01.06 12:43:31:120 DsSipLlApi.Wire - Sending UDP packet on 10.85.101.44:32791, destination 10.20.0.198:5060

SIP/2.0 200 OK

 

2 Replies 2

bankspb
Level 1
Level 1

!
policy normalization From_ISDN_Called_Number_Prefix_329_Remove
uri-component update request-uri user 329 ""
end policy
!
policy normalization From_ISDN_Called_Number_Prefix_332_Remove
uri-component update request-uri user 08083327700 7700
end policy
!
policy normalization Remove_Prefix_0800_for_0800-Calls-from-CUCM-to-CVP
uri-component update request-uri user 0800 ""
end policy
!
policy normalization Remove_Prefix_0801_for_0801-Calls-from-CUCM-to-CVP-with-Courtesy-Callback
uri-component update request-uri user 0801 ""
end policy
!

Hi,

Did you figure out the way out i am having the same problem with CUSP 9.1.4 version.